Output 33c659bbf330f149f2632495c73dc28221d61ec8c553175594f0f1cd1a1bae28:1

value
22113409
script pubkey
OP_HASH160 OP_PUSHBYTES_20 132f4401b74a54bbf9133e9ab318af93e7e214a1 OP_EQUAL
address
33STPGEqNaTL1JYceu8wv2m6AKaXB84PSL
transaction
33c659bbf330f149f2632495c73dc28221d61ec8c553175594f0f1cd1a1bae28
spent
true